How they compare

Panama currently reports 6,810 Square kilometres against 6,455 Square kilometres in Guinea-Bissau, a difference of 355 Square kilometres.

That makes Panama's figure about 1.1 times Guinea-Bissau's.

Across all 63 years both countries report, Panama has been ahead every year.

Guinea-Bissau ranks 110th and Panama ranks 107th of 193 countries.

Panama has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Guinea-Bissau Panama Difference Ahead
1960s 2,813 Square kilometres 5,568 Square kilometres 2,754 Square kilometres Panama
1970s 2,949 Square kilometres 5,461 Square kilometres 2,512 Square kilometres Panama
1980s 3,339 Square kilometres 5,938 Square kilometres 2,599 Square kilometres Panama
1990s 4,125 Square kilometres 6,618 Square kilometres 2,493 Square kilometres Panama
2000s 5,325 Square kilometres 7,090 Square kilometres 1,765 Square kilometres Panama
2010s 5,626 Square kilometres 7,183 Square kilometres 1,557 Square kilometres Panama
2020s 6,382 Square kilometres 6,758 Square kilometres 376.23 Square kilometres Panama

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Land resources are one of the four components of the natural environment: water, air, land and living resources. In this context land is both: a physical "milieu" necessary for the development of natural vegetation as well as cultivated vegetation; a resource for human activities. The data presented here give information concerning land use state and changes (e.g. agricultural land, forest land).
